Now you can own a complete year and mint mark set of Susan B. Anthony Dollars. The set includes the years 1979, 1980, 1981 and 1999 with P, D and S mint marks - Philadelphia, Denver and San Francisco, respectively. Each come encapsulated in clear acrylic and are placed in a velvet case with niches for each. The Susan B. Anthony Dollar was the first small-size dollar coin and the first circulating coin to feature an identifiable woman. It honors Susan B. Anthony (1820-1906), the women's rights pioneer whose work led to the 19th Amendment to the Constitution that assures women the right to vote. The reverse design is adapted from the Apollo 11 mission patch and shows an American eagle landing on the moon. The earth can be seen above the eagle's head. The 16 Susan B. The term proof refers to the method of manufacture, not the condition of the coin. Regular production coins in mint state have coruscating, frosty luster, soft details and minor imperfections. Proof coins can usually be distinguished by their sharpness of detail, high-wire edge and extremely brilliant, mirror-like surface. A proof is a speciment striking of coinage for presentation, souvenir, exhibition or numismatic purposes. In 2006, the United States Mint introduced a collectible, un-circulated version of the popular gold, silver and platinum American Eagle Coins. All three of the American Eagle Un-circulated Coins carry the same stunning designs found on their proof counterparts. This coin weighs approximately 0.25 ounces and measures 0.65" in diameter. The term "un-circulated" refers to the specialized minting process used to create these coins. Although they are similar in appearance to American Eagle Bullion Coins, these new un-circulated coins are distinguished by the presence of a mint mark, indicating their production facility, and by the use of burnished coin blanks, which are hand-fed into specially- adapted coining presses one at a time. Each American Eagle Un-circulated Coin is carefully inspected before it is encapsulated in plastic, protecting its pristine finish. This quality (GRADE) rating is determined on the Sheldon scale, on which points are deducted from 70 for each flaw or imperfection on a coin's surface. A 70 is thus the highest grade a coin can achieve, with no flaws visible to the unaided eye. All American Eagle Gold Coins are legal-tender and contain 91.67% (22ct) gold. The gold weight and diameter will vary with each coin denomination, as specified below. Each coin is backed by the U.S. Government for weight and content. Coin Features: Obverse: A rendition of Augustus Saint-Gaudens' full length figure of Lady Liberty with flowing hair, holding a torch in her right hand and an olive branch in her left hand. Reverse: The reverse design, by sculptor Miley Busiek, features a male eagle carrying an olive branch flying above a nest containing a female eagle and her hatchlings.

About Silver American Eagles: 1986 was the first year of the Silver American Eagle program. Affordability, credibility, and beauty are the qualities that have made American Eagle Silver Bullion coins the world's best-selling silver coins. As genuine legal tender, they are the only silver bullion coins whose weight and purity are guaranteed by the United States Government. They're also the only silver coins allowed in an IRA. Silver has historically been the most affordable precious metal. Each coin contains a minimum of one troy ounce of 99.9% pure silver, giving it the highest pure silver content of any coin in U.S. history. About NGC: Numismatic Guarantee Corporation, abbreviated as "NGC", is a third party grading service that certifies and grades coins. They are considered a third party service because they are not directly controlled by any coin dealers. NGC is one of the most popular and well respected independent coin grading companies.
